					This keymap is my preferred layout (after a certain amount of experimentation).
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					The rationale behind the design is as follows:
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					I grew up typing from a very early age and thus never learned the "correct" way
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					to touch type (essentially, I'm self-taught). As a, result my fingers don't
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					tend to stay on the "home keys" and occasionally my right hand wants to type
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					keys that are on the left of the keyboard, and vice versa.
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					Hence, despite liking the idea of split keyboards in principle, I've never been
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					able to get on with them because the split simply doesn't work with my style of
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					typing. The Ergodox solves this neatly by virtue of having a few extra keys in
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					the "middle" of the keyboard which I can utilise for deliberate redundancy.
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					Thus in this keymap there are two "6" keys (one on the left, one on the right)
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					and likewise Y, H, G, and B are all duplicated to enable one-handed patterns
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					that I use frequently (e.g. "byobu" with the right hand, "yes" with the left,
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					etc.).
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					I occasionally use the numeric pad for data entry, thus this is duplicated
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					under the natural home position of the right hand in layer 1 (activated by
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					holding one of the right thumb buttons), while the cursor keys are duplicated
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					under the classic WASD gaming layout of the left hand in layer 2 (activated by
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					holding one of the left thumb buttons). Various other useful keys also appear
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					in these layers (brackets and symbols for coding in layer 1, navigation and
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					F-keys in layer 2, etc.).
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					Finally, modifier keys like Ctrl, Shift, and Alt, along with Backspace and
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					Enter are all in traditional locations in an effort to reuse existing muscle
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					memory as much as possible (keys like =, #, and ' are in layer 1). The layout
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					maps are in the comments of keymap_dave.c so I won't bother duplicating them
 | 
				
			||||||
 | 
					here.
